A SET OF TWO CYLINDRICAL PORCELAIN VESSELS, REPUBLIC PERIODChina, 1912-1949. The first lot being a finely enameled cylindrical vase depicting two court ladies in the palace garden, a poem above, the upper rim with gold lining. The second lot is a cylindrical hat stand with four lobed apertures, depicting a courtyard scene, the base with an apocryphal six-character Tongzhi reign mark.Provenance: German private collection.Condition: Good condition with wear, hairlines, remnants of a former mounting on the hat stand, and manufacturing irregularities.Weight: 998 g (vase) and 1,426 g (hat stand)Dimensions: Height 28.3 cm and 28.5 cm
